    Oracle Database 11g: Administration Workshop I Release 2

    This Database 11g Administration training gives you a firm foundation in basic database administration, including how to install and maintain an Oracle database. Learn about architecture and how the database components work and interact.
    Learn ToThis Oracle Database 11g: Administration Workshop I Release 2 course explores the fundamentals of basic database administration. Expert Oracle University instructors will reinforce topics with structured hands-on practices that will prepare you for the corresponding Oracle Certified Associate exam.

    Training Requirements

    This Oracle Database 11g: Administration Workshop I Release 2 course fulfills the training requirement for an Oracle Certification Path. Only instructor-led online (LVC, LWC), in-class (ILT) or Training On Demand courses fulfill the requirement. Please note that Self-Study Courses and Knowledge Center courses do not fulfill the training requirement.
